Wiesbaden: Performance of “Wiesbaden Prince’s Kidnapping” PDF Print E-mail
Friday, 18 November 2016.
visbaden 28112016The villa "Clementine" in Wiesbaden premiered theatre show "Wiesbaden Prince's Kidnapping" (inspired by the ideas and text of journalist Armin Conrad), whose preparation and realization was supported by the Embassy of the Republic of Serbia in Berlin. The premiere was attended by Consul General of the Republic of Serbia in Frankfurt, Ms. Aleksandra Djordjevic, representative of the Embassy M. Stipic, City of Wiesbaden's Head of Cultural Affairs Rose-Lore Scholz, as well as members of the "Wiesbaden Literature House – the Villa Clementine" and citizens of Wiesbaden.

Madrid: Exhibition opens at the Institute of Military History and Culture PDF Print E-mail
Tuesday, 15 November 2016.
On the occasion of the centenary of the establishment of diplomatic relations between the Kingdom of Serbia and the Kingdom of Spain, the Embassy of the Republic of Serbia and the Institute of Military History and Culture in Madrid co-hosted a lecture on the relations between Serbia and Spain during the First World War, held in the Institute on 15 November 2016.

Tokyo: Ambassador on a visit to Hofu city PDF Print E-mail
Monday, 14 November 2016.
At the invitation of Masato Matsuura, Mayor of the city of Hofu, located in Yamaguchi Prefecture, Ambassador of the Republic of Serbia to Japan Nenad Glisic was on a two-day visit to the city that would play host to the Serbian volleyball national team during the 2020 Tokyo Olympic Games.
